St Michael, Coventry, Baptisms, G to L

PLEASE NOTE:- THIS IS A COLLECTION OF BAPTISMS AND NOT THE COMPLETE LIST FOR ST MICHAEL, COVENTRY

George Garlick – Baptised – 6th November 1843 – Child of William and Hannah of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Cordwainer
William Garlick – Born – 19th October 1874 – Baptised – 20th November 1874 – Child of William and Emma of Brickiln Lane – Fathers occupation – Cordwainer
Lillian Gardner – Born 3rd May 1890 – Baptised – 1st June 1890 – Child of George William and Emily of Gosford Dtreet – Fathers occupation – Corn Dealer
Thomas Gardner – Baptised 5th November 1847 – Child of Edward and Mabel of Cow Lane – Fathers occupation – Carpenter
Amy Eunice Gascoigne – Baptised – 14th March 1884 – Born – 8th January 1876 – Child of John and Harriet Gascoigne – Fathers occupation – Mechanic
Eliza Gascoigne – Baptised 14th March 1884 – Born – 12th May 1872 – Child of John and Harriet Gascoigne of Park Side – Fathers Occupation – Mechanic
Louisa Jane Gascoigne – Baptised – 14th March 1884 – Born 12th August 1874 - Child of John and Harriet Gascoigne of Park Side – Fathers Occupation – Mechanic
Elizabeth Gilbert – Baptised – 5th May 1834 – Child of James and Mary Gilbert of St Michaels –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Sarah Ann Gloster – Born 7th February 1871 – Baptised 2nd April 1871 – Child of William and Elizabeth of Upper Well Street – Fathers occupation - Machinist
Thomas Goode – Baptised – 1st May 1843 – Child of John and Sarah of High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ver.
Thomas Goodman – Baptised – 13th November 1843 – Child of William and Maria of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Ellen Selina Gorsuch – Born – 22nd January 1869 – Baptised – 7th march 1869 – Child of William and Caroline of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Ada Emmeline Gossett – Born 26th January 1872 – Baptised 7th April 1872 – Child of John and Elizabeth of Barracks – Fathers occupation – Royal Horse Artillery
Mary Gooch – Baptised 21st march 1837 – Child of Thomas Longridge and Ruthanna of Warwick Road – Fathers occupation – Engineer
Jane Grant – Baptised 19th June 1843 – Child of Thomas and Mary of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Miller
Mary Ann Gray – Baptised 2nd February 1840 – Child of Simon and Susan of Barracks – Fathers occupation – Soldier in 4th Dragoon Guards
Emily Louisa Greatex – Born – 9th June 1871 – Baptised – 2nd July 1871 – Child of Charles (deceased) and Eliza of St John Street – Occupation – Watch Maker
Edmund Green – Baptised 8th April 1844 – Child of Edmund and Susannah of White Friars Lane- Fathers occupation – Weaver
Florence Green – Born 9th July 1877 – Baptised – 2nd September 1877 – Child of John and Ann of Cox Street – Fathers occupation – Victualler
Francis Green – Baptised 12th April 1852 – Child of Thomas and Elizabeth of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watchmaker
Frederick Green – Baptised – 7th September 1846 - Child of George and Harriett Green of Earl St –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Mark Green – Baptised 30th June 1845 – Illegitimate child of Mary Green of Park Side
Susannah Green – Baptised 20th March 1842 – Child of Edmund and Susannah of White Friars Lane –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Thomas Newbold Green – Baptised – 27th October 1863 – Child of Mary Green of White Friars St
Edward Greenway – Baptised – 30th April 1834 – Child of William and Eunice greenway of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Sophia Griffin – Baptised 19th June 1843 – Child of Mary Ann of Jordan Well – occupation – Servant
Tom Griffiths – Born 29th May 1858 – Baptised 27th April 1859 – Child of Joseph and Jane of Cow lane – Fathers ocuupation – Weaver
Emma Gutteridge – Baptised 7th march 1842 – Child of Charles and Ann of House of Industry – Fathers occupation – weaver
John Charles Haddon – Born 13th January 1873 Baptised 7th September 1873 – Child of Charles and Sarah Ann of Smithford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Henry Hadley – Baptised 4th November 1840 – Child of Henry and Eliza of Little Park street – Fathers occupation – Portition ?
Mary Ann Hall – Baptised 17th March 1840 – Child of Thomas and Elizabeth Hall of Mill Lane –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
William Henry Hall - Baptised 5th April 1858 – Child of Thomas and Emma of New Buildings – Fathers occupation – Bricklayer
Mary Jane Hammersley – Baptised 5th November 1849 – Child of William and Sarah of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Trimming Maker
Emma Hannah – Baptised 8th March 1826 – Child of David and Mary of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Baker
Esther Hannah – Baptised – 6th December 1819 – Child of David and Mary of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Baker
Rebekah Hannah – Baptised 10th Decmber 1823 – Child of David and Mary of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Baker
Selina Hannah – Baptised 12th December 1821 – Child of David and Mary of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Baker
Walter Harden – Baptised – 3rd February 1851 – Child of William and Martha harden of Much Park St –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Clara Harris – Baptised – 4th January 1874 – Child of John and Hannah of Fleet Street – Fathers occupation – Butcher
Elizabeth Harris – Baptised – 14th April 1852 – Child of Thomas and Ann Harris of Grey Frairs Lane – Fathers occupation – Labourer
John Harris – Baptised 5th October 1840 – Child of Caroline Harris of Jordan Well
William Walter Hart – Baptised – 14th April 1852 – Child of John and Elizabeth Hart of Much Park St – Fathers Occupation – Gardener
Thomas Hassall –Baptised 12th April 1852 – Child of George and Mary of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Weaver
Elizabeth Hannah Haughton – Baptised – 19th February 1862 – Child of John and Mary Ann of White Friars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ver.
Mary Ann Haughton – Baptised – 19th February 1862 – Child of John and Mary Ann of White Friars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Josiah Hawley – Baptised 28th March 1837 – Child of Thomas and Maria of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
James Hayfield – Baptised 17th April 1854 – Child of William and Martha of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Hair Dresser
Lucy Heap – Baptised 2nd December 1887 – Born 11th November 1887 – Child of Herbert and Elizabeth Heap of White Friars St
Sophia Heatley – Baptised – 27th April 1841 – Child of Rowland and Martha of House of Industry –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Thomas Alexander Heatley – Born 10th October 1868 – Baptised 6th December 1868 – Child of William and Ann of West Orchard – Fathers occupation - Warehouse man
John Lea Herbert – Baptised – 29th July 1852 – Ilegitimate son of Jane of Smithford Street – Occupation – Winder
Richard William Hewat – Baptised 24th October 1849 – Child of William and Mary of Nettle Hill, Combe Fields – (rest Missing due to being burnt)
Beatrice Harriet Hewitt – Born 7th May 1867 - Baptised 7th July 1867 – Child of Alceus and Maria of Smithford Street – Fathers occupation - Watchmaker
Ellen Newbury Hewitt – Born – 6th February 1869 – Baptised – 4th July 1869 – Child of David Newbury and Maria of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Harriet Hewitt – Baptised – 14th April 1867 – Child of Edward and Harriet of Red Lane –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Sarah Ann Florence Hewitt – Born 4th November 1874 – Baptised – 6th December 1874 – Child of Charles and Emma of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Emma Higginson – Born 1850 –Baptised – 1st July 1869 – Child of William and Mary of Red lane –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Jesse Higginson – Born 7th June 1869 – Baptised – 1st July 1869 – Child of Jesse and Betsy of Red Lane –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Charles Henry Hill – born – 6th October 1875 – Baptised – 12th November 1875 – Child of Henry and Sarah Ann of London Road – Fathers occupation – Fitter
Emily Hinds – Born ?th March 1854 – Baptised 19th April 1854 – Child of James and Emma of Jordan Well – Fathers occupation – Chemist
Fanny Rebecca Hipwell – Born – 30th July 1877 – Baptised – 2nd September 1877 – child of Joseph and Fanny Rebecca of Vicar Lane – – Occupation – House Keeper
Ellen Jane Hitchins – Baptised – 27th April 1859 – Child of William and Eliza of Jordan Well –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Mary Ann Hitchins – Born – 29th January 1871 – Baptised – 10th March 1871 – Child of James and Elizabeth of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Francis Hitchman – Baptised – 2nd August 1864 – Child of William and Rebecca of Cox Street – Fathers occupation – Plush Weaver
George Henry Hodkinson – Born 2nd May 1866 – Baptised 3rd June 1866 – Child of Henry and Ann of Ford Street Fathers occupation - Iron Worker
John Hough Hinds – Born 24th February 1866 – Baptised 26th March 1866 – Child of James and Emma of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ation - Chemist and Druggist
Margaret Annie Elizabeth Hipwell –Born 15th January 1872 - Baptised 7th April 1872 – Child of Joseph and Fanny of Vicar Lane – Fathers occupation – Hostler
Mary Ann Hitchins – Born 29th January 1871 – Baptised 10th March 1871 – Child of James and Elizabeth of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ation - Watch Maker
William Hitchens – Baptised – 30 April 1833 – Child of William and Catherine of St Michaels –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Henry Holliday – Baptised – 12th July 1867 – Child of Henry and Catherine of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Luke Holmes – Baptised – 15th March 1840 – Child of Mary Holmes of the House of Industry – Occupation – Winder
Elizabeth Holtham – Baptised 13th December 1826 – Child of John and Martha of St Michaels – fathers occupation – Weaver
James Holtham – Baptised 15th February 1836 – Child of John and Martha of Little park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Selina Holtham – Baptised 12th July 1820 – Child of John and Martha of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Weaver
William Holtham – Baptised 10th June 1822 – Child of John and Martha of St Michaels –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Alfred Howe – Baptised – 8th October 1860 – Child of Edward and Mary Howe of Mile Lane – Fathers Occupation – Labourer.
Sarah Hunt – Baptised – 7th August 1853 – Child of John and Eliza Hunt of Grey Friars Lane –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Arthur Hyde – Baptised – 7th September 1846 – Child of Robert and Ellen Elliott Hyde of Much Park St –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Caroline Hyde – Baptised 1st June 1842 – Child of Henry and Ann of Much Park street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Elizabeth Ann Hyde – Baptised 7th September 1846 – Child of Robert and Ellen Elliott Hyde of Much Park St –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Thomas Robert Hyde – Baptised – 7th September 1846 – Child of Robert and Ellen Elliott Hyde of Much Park St –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Thomas Isherwood – Born 10th May 1890 – Baptised – 6th June 1890 – Child of James and Elizabeth of St John street – Fathers occupation – Gunner, R. A.
Arthur Jackson – Born – 4th November 1874 – Baptised – 6th December 1874 – Child of Thomas and Mary Ann of Smithford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
John Jackson – Baptised 8th April 1844 – Child of John and Ann of Mill Lane – Fathers occupation – Cordwainer
William Jackson – Born 24th May 1870 – Baptised 10th March 1871 – Child of Thomas and Sarah of St Johns Street – Fathers occupation - Cabinet Maker
Caroline Eliza James – Baptised – 26th April 1836 – Child of Daniel and Isabella James of High St – Fathers occupation – Provision Dealer
Charles William James – Baptised 3rd November 1847 – Child of David Earl and Sarah Martha of Smithford Street – Fathers occupation – Provision Dealer
Isabella Sarah James – Baptised – 26th April 1836 – Child of Daniel and Isabella James of High St – Fathers Occupation – Provision Dealer
George Jeffries – Born – 1st July 1864 – Baptised – 1st August 1864 – Child of John and Selina of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Dyer
Joel James Jeffs – Born – 29th June 1867 – Baptised – 17th July 1867 – Child of William and Jennifer of Grey Friars Street – Fathers occupation – Vitualler
Ann Maria Jenkins – Born 21st November 1868 – Baptised – 12th June 1871 – Child of Richard and Mary Ann of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Richard Jenkins – Baptised – 25th February 1850 – Child of Richard and Mary Ann of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Frances Ada Jewell – Aged 3 years – Baptised 7th July 1867 – Child of Sarah of Albion Street – Occupation - Straw Bonnet Maker
Arthur Johnson – Baptised – 3rd August 1853 – Child of Arthur and Anne Johnson of High St – Fathers Occupation – Printer
Rose Jinks – Born – 10th February 1856 – Baptised – 7th July 1869 – Child of Charles and Dorcas of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Hand Cuff Maker
Charlotte Alice Johnson - Born - 28th January 1871 - Baptised - 5th March 1871 - Child of William and Charlotte of Jordan Well - Fathers occupation - Watch Maker
Edwin Johnson – Baptised 29th April 1863 – Child of Edwin and Ann Louisa of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Painter
Emma Angliss Johnson – Baptised – 19th April 1852 – Child of Thomas George and Elizabeth Angliss Johnson of Earl St – Fathers Occupation – Saddler
James Johnson – Baptised 27th December 1850 – Child of Thomas and Hannah of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Weaver
John Henry Johnson - Born - 24th December 1865 - Baptised - 4th February 1866 - Child of William and Charlotte of Jordan Well - Fathers occupation - Dyer
Mary Ann Johnson – Baptised – 10th May 1843 – Child of William Henry and Elizabeth of Mill Lane - Fathers occupation – Draper
Phoebe Johnson – Baptised – 27th April 1841 – Child of Phoebe of the House of Industry – Occupation – Weaver
Sarah Louisa Johnson - Born - 20th March 1872 - Baptised - 4th May 1873 - Child of William and Charlotte of Jordan Well - Fathers occupation - Watch Cap Manufacturor
Selina Stour Johnson - Born 22nd March 1864 - Baptised - 3rd October 1864 - Child of William and Charlotte of St John Street - Fathers occupation - Trimming ? Maker
William Samuel Johnson – Born 5th June 1869 – Baptised – 4th July 1869 – Child of William and Charlotte of Jordan Well – Fathers occupation – Trimming Card Maker
Alexander Owen Johnston - Baptised - 7th February 1858 - Child of Thomas and Maria of Gosford Street - Fathers occupation - Carpenter
Andrew Johnston - Baptised - 4th July 1860 - Child of Thomas and Maria of Gosford Street - Fathers occupation - Carpenter
Donald Philip Johnston - Baptised - 2nd March 1862 - Child of Thomas and Ann Maria of Gosford Street - Fathers occupation - Carpenter
Louis Johnston - Born - 20th April 1864 - Baptised - 30th May 1864 - Child of Thomas and Maria of Gosford Street - Fathers occupation - Carpenter
Rosina Johnston - Baptised - 26th December 1851 - Child of Thomas and Ann Maria of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Carpenter
Frederick Judd (twin) - Baptised 16th May 1849 – Child of Charles and Ann Judd of Warwick Lane – Fathers Occupation – Gardener
James Judd – Baptised – 15th February 1862 – Child of James and Ann of Bright Street –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Rebecca Judd (twin) – Baptised – 6th May 1849 – Child of Charles and Ann Judd of Warwick Lane – Fathers Occupation – Gardener
Amelia Frances Keene – Born 7th January 1870 – Baptised 30th August 1871 – Child of Joseph and Grace Maria of Hill Fields – Fathers occupation: NONE
Elizabeth Jane Keene – Born 27th January 1868 – Baptised 30th August 1871 – Child of Joseph and Grace Maria of Hill Fields – Fathers occupation - Railway Porter
William Keene – Baptised 29th May 1842 – Child of William and Mary of Little Park street – Fathers occupation – Tailor.
Henry Kenning – Baptised 20th March 1842 – Child of Charles and Charlotte of White Friars Street –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Edward Kerby – Born 25th Feb 1866 – Baptised 28th March 1866 – Child of Edward and Elizabeth of Trafalger Street – Fathers occupation: Watch Maufacturer
Emma Kimberly – Baptised 6th May 1855 – Child of Thomas and Sarah of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Weaver
Jane Kimberley - Baptised 10th February 1836 – child of Samuel and Caroline of Mill Lane –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Margaret Jane Kimberley – Baptised 19th June 1843 – Child of William and caroline of White Frairs Lane – Fathers occupation – Tailor
Thomas Kimberley – Baptised 6th May 1855 – Child of Thomas and Sarah of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ation - Weaver
Matilda King– Baptised 1st June 1842 – Child of Benjamin and Catherine of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Baker
Sarah King – Baptised 15th February 1836 – Child of Benjamin and Catherine of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Baker
Henry Kirk – Baptised – 12th April 1852 – Child of George and Ann Kirk of Much Park St – Fathers occupation – Weaver
James Edward Kirk – Baptised – 6th May 1833 – Child of George and Ann Kirk of St Michaels – Fathers Occupation – Weaver
Florence Knibbs – Born 13th October 1889 – Baptised 8th November 1889 – Child of Charles and Elizabeth of 33 court, 5 house, Gosford Street – Fathers occupation – Machinist
Josiah Knibbs– Baptised – 12th February 1862 – Child of Josiah and Martha of Brickiln Lane – Fathers occupation – Labourer
Elizabeth Ladbrook – Baptised – 27th April 1836 – Child of James and Charlotte Ladbrook of Much Park St – Fathers Occupation – Labourer
Charlotte Lamb - Born - 31st October 1891 - Baptised - 25th November 1892 - Child of Walter and Sarah Ann of Brick Kiln Lane -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Emma Lamb - Baptised - 2nd March 1856 - Child of William and Charlotte of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Emma Lamb - Baptised - 12th June 1866 - Child of John and Charlotte of Smithford Street - Fathers occupation - Dyer
James Lamb - Born June 1869 - Baptised - 12th August 1870 - Child of William and Charlotte of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
William Lamb - Baptised - 11th March 1863 - Child of William and Charlotte of Gosford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Emily Lapworth – Born – 3rd February 1867 – Baptised – 17th April 1867 – Child of William and Eliza of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
William Lapworth – Baptised 1st June 1842 – child of James and sarah of Gosford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
Ellen Laxon – Baptised 9th February 1836 – Child of William and Elizabeth Marsh of Warwick Row – Fathers occupation – Surgeon
Emma Louisa Laxon - Born - 24th June 1894 - Baptised - 5th August 1894 - Child of William Harry and Sarah Louisa of 113 Gosford Street - fathers occupation - Picture frame Gilder
William Laxon – Baptised – 25th April 1841 – Child of Charles and Mary of White Frairs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ver
William Harry Laxon - Born - 29th January 1873 - Baptised - 2nd March 1873 - Child of Sarah Louisa Johnson - Child of Henry and Emma of White Friars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Bertha Lea – Baptised – 8th July 1867 – Child of Peter and Eliza of Freeth Street – Fathers occupation – Non Stated
Alfred Lee – Born 5th November 1881 – Baptised – 4th December 1881 – Child of Thomas and Henrietta of Spon End –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Ann Lee – Baptised 8th April 1844 – Child of James and Eliza of Bayley Lane – Fathers occupation – Carpenter and Joiner
Edward Lee – Born – 27th November 1873 – Baptised – 4th January 1874 – Child of Edward Richard and Mary Ann of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Ellen Lee – Born 1st August 1867 – Baptised – 7th July 1867 – Child of Edward Richard and Mary Ann of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Hannah Lee – Born – 24th May 1871 – Baptised – 12th June 1871 – Child of Edward Richard and Mary Ann of Little park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Henry Basford Lee – Born – 24th May 1869 – Baptised – 4th July 1869 – Child of Edward Richard and Mary Ann of Little Park Street -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Henry Edward Lee - Born - 4th April 1897 - Baptised - 29th May 1897 - Child of Henry Basford and Ellen Eliza Jane of 16 Ct, 6 H, Little Park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Isabella Lee – Born 24th October 1875 – Baptised – 19th November 1875 – Child of Edward Richard and Maria of Little Park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Isabella Helen Lee - Born - 27th June 1899 - Baptised - 14th July 1899 - Child of Henry Basford and Ellen Eliza Jane of 16 Ct, 6 H, Little Park Street - Fathers occupation - Jewell Maker
Alice Leeson – Born 27th May 1871 – Baptised 14th August 1871 – Child of Louisa of Much Park Street – Occupation - Weaver
Mary Elizabeth Leeson – Baptised 3rd May 1865 – Child of Walter and Matilda of Cow Lane – Fathers occupation - Plumber
Rosamund Lenton – Born – 30th November 1873 – Baptised – 4th January 1874 – Child of Charles and Ann of Grove Street – Weaver
Thomas Reynolds Lewin – Baptised 5th November 1849 – Child of David and Ann of Hertford Street – Fathers occupation – Book Binder
Amelia Lidwell – Born – 13th April 1865 – Baptised – 18th December 1881 - Child of Thomas and Ann of East Street – Fathers occupation – Weaver.
John Lines – Baptised – 16th March 1840 – Child of William and Esther Lines of High St – Fathers occupation – Cordwainer
Henry John Linzell – Baptised 5th April 1858 – Child of Henry and Mary of Barracks – Fathers occupation - Private in 15th Hussars
William George Loakes – Baptised – 6th December 1874 – Child of William George and Harriett of Freeth Street – Fathers occupation – labourer
Henry Lockett– Baptised 25th November 1881 – Child of Henry and Mary Ann of Much Park Street – Fathers occupation – Tailor
Frederick Lockton – Baptised – 24th April 1859 – Child of Emma of House of Industry – occupation – Weaver
William Riley Longslow – Baptised – 3rd November 1863 – Child of James Riley and Ann Riley Longslow of St John St – Fathers Occupation – unreadable
Albert Edward Ludford - Born - 15th April 1893 - Baptised - 19th May 1893 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ice of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Charlotte Mary Ludford - Born - 15th January 1898 - Baptised - 4th February 1898 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ice of 14 Ct, 6 H,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Edward Ludford - Born - 2nd March 1868 - Baptised - 1st April 1868 - Child of Henry and Mary of St John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Ellen Ludford - Born - 2nd September 1872 - Baptised - 27th September 1872 - Child of Henry and Mary of St John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Henry Ludford - Born - 22nd April 1865 - Baptised - 31st May 1865 - Child of Henry and Mary of Cow Lane -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Henry Edward Ludford - Born - 10th February 1900 - Baptised - 2nd March 1900 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ice of 14 Ct, 6 H, Much park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Joseph Ludford - Born - 4th March 1875 - Baptised - 26th March 1875 - Child of Henry and Mary of St John Street -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Mary Ann Eliza Ludford - Baptised - 6th September 1863 - Child of Henry and Mary of Brickiln Lane - Fathers occupation - Weaver
Mary Edith Ludford - Born - 24th October 1894 - Baptised - 2nd December 1894 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ice of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
Thomas Ludford – Baptised 9th January 1881 – Chilf of Thomas and Elizabeth of Aylesford Street – Fathers occupation – Watch Maker
Thomas Walter Ludford - Born - 27th January 1902 - Baptised - 2nd March 1902 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ice - Fathers occupation - Machinist
William John Ludford - Born - 9th December 1903 - Baptised - 1st January 1904 - Child of Edward and Charlotte Alice of 14 Ct, 6 H, Much Park Street - Fathers occupation - Machinist
